FHA loan specialists in Cudahy, Wisconsin help borrowers secure government-backed mortgages with lower down payments and flexible credit requirements. These loans are popular in the Milwaukee area for first-time homebuyers and those with moderate incomes. Wisconsin law requires all mortgage loan originators to be licensed through the Nationwide Multistate Licensing System (NMLS).
What Does a FHA Loan Specialist in Cudahy Cost?
Typical costs for an FHA loan in Wisconsin include an upfront mortgage insurance premium (UFMIP) of 1.75 percent of the loan amount and an annual mortgage insurance premium (MIP) of 0.55 to 0.85 percent. Closing costs usually range from 2 to 5 percent of the purchase price, covering appraisal, title insurance, and lender fees. Costs vary by lender and loan amount.
